ÿþ<html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ml" lang="en" xml:lang="en"> <head> <title>Fernwood</title> <me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html; charset=iso-8859-1" /> <meta name="description" content="" /> <meta name="keywords" content="" /> <meta name="class" content="" /> <style> P {FONT: 8pt Arial; COLOR: black;} </style> </head> <body> <p align="left" style="padding-bottom:0px;">Fernwood s boats are always a fascinating mix of finest quality joinery and high technology and this 63 footer was no exception. The interior style had the familiar Fernwood trademarks - notably the  dropped flat ceiling that runs the length of the saloon and galley. And, as ever, there are plenty of careful details, like the laser cut marquetry inlays. </p> <table style="width :450px;"> <tr> <td colspan ="2"> <table> <tr> <td style="vertical-align :top;"><img border="0" src="images/repent_at_leisure/photo1.jpg" alt="canal boat"></td> <td style="vertical-align :top;"><img border="0" src="images/repent_at_leisure/photo2.jpg" alt="canal boat"> </td> </tr> </table> </td> </tr> <tr> <td> <img border="0" src="images/repent_at_leisure/photo3.jpg" alt="canal boat"> </td> <td style="vertical-align :top;padding-left:10px;"> <p align="justify">The saloon featured an L-shaped sofa, offering the option of extra accommodation, and unusually the doors of the floor-level galley cupboards were painted rather than wood finished. </p> <p align="justify">Beyond the galley a versatile  day room acted as dinette, floating office or two more beds. The walk-through bathroom was especially smart, having  invisible push-to-open cupboards built under the gunwales and handsome fittings including an elegant stone basin on wooden plinth. </p> <p align="justify">But it wouldn t be a Fernwood without the technology. It is an all-electric boat so there was a 7kw generator which auto-starts when on-board electric loads rise above 1kw. And to last year s electrically lifting end for the cross double bed, Fernwood added an electric rear hatch! </p> </td> </tr> </table> </body> </html>
